Position Overview

Ultimate Staffing is actively seeking an experienced Equipment and Tool Installation Manager to join their client's innovative team in Durham, North Carolina.This supervisor position is an exciting opportunity for individuals with expertise in managing capital projects and manufacturing startups.

Responsibilities

The Equipment and Tool Installation Manager will:

  • Engage with equipment manufacturers to review installation requirements and site preparation needs.
  • Participate in factory acceptance testing (FAT) and pre-shipment reviews to resolve potential issues before equipment arrival.
  • Develop installation packages in coordination with engineering and facilities design teams.
  • Lead contractor qualification, bid evaluation, and selection for installation across various scopes.
  • Negotiate contracts with installation contractors and OEM field service providers.
  • Manage day-to-day contractor performance, ensuring schedule adherence and quality compliance.
  • Oversee equipment move-in, rigging, and all necessary mechanical, electrical, and piping connections.
  • Verify utility readiness and maintain installation schedules aligned with construction milestones.
  • Track progress against plans, identifying risks early and driving resolution to stay on schedule.
  • Own the punch-list process, ensuring all items are addressed before commissioning activities begin.
  • Provide support during Site Acceptance Testing (SAT).

Qualifications

  • 5 years of experience in industrial equipment installation, capital project execution, or manufacturing startup.
  • Experience managing installation contractors across mechanical, electrical, and/or piping scopes.
  • Direct involvement in site acceptance testing (SAT) or commissioning of complex industrial equipment.
  • Ability to read and interpret engineering drawings and utility layout documents.
  • Proven ability to coordinate across OEM vendors, general contractors, and internal engineering teams.
  • Strong working knowledge of site EHS requirements including LOTO and contractor safety management.
  • Bachelor's degree in Engineering required.

Desired Skills

  • Experience with greenfield facility build-out or manufacturing site startup.
  • Familiarity with FAT, SAT, and OEM engagement during equipment procurement.
  • Degree or equivalent training in mechanical, electrical, industrial, or process engineering; PMP, OSHA 30, or rigger certification is a plus.
  • Experience building or scaling an installation function, developing standards, and onboarding team members.
